Synopsis
========

A vulnerability in ProFTPD could lead to a Denial of Service condition.

Background
==========

ProFTPD is an advanced and very configurable FTP server.

Affected packages
=================

    -------------------------------------------------------------------
     Package              /     Vulnerable     /            Unaffected
    -------------------------------------------------------------------
  1  net-ftp/proftpd              < 1.3.7a                  >= 1.3.7a

Description
===========

It was found that ProFTPD did not properly handle invalid SCP commands.

Impact
======

An authenticated remote attacker could issue invalid SCP commands,
possibly resulting in  a Denial of Service condition.

Workaround
==========

There is no known workaround at this time.

Resolution
==========

All ProFTPD users should upgrade to the latest version:

  # emerge --sync
  # emerge --ask --oneshot --verbose ">=net-ftp/proftpd-1.3.7a"
